Other Events On May 23, 2001 Maytag Corporation announced it would explore strategic alternatives that include the potential sale of G.S. Blodgett, the company's commercial cooking products manufacturer headquartered in Burlington, VT. On June 5, 2001 Maytag Corporation entered into an agreement to acquire Amana Appliances from Goodman Global Holding Company, Inc. Goodman, a privately held company, purchased Amana in 1997. Maytag will pay $325 million, with approximately 95 percent in cash and the remainder in Maytag stock. The acquisition, which is subject to regulatory approval and normal adjustments at closing, is expected to close during the third quarter. Included in the agreement are Amana's major appliance and commercial microwave oven businesses. Item 7. Financial Statements and Exhibits (c) Exhibits.
